#include "v3dv_private.h"

#include "broadcom/cle/v3dx_pack.h"
#include "compiler/nir/nir_builder.h"
#include "vk_format_info.h"

static nir_ssa_def *
gen_rect_vertices(nir_builder *b)
{
   nir_intrinsic_instr *vertex_id =
      nir_intrinsic_instr_create(b->shader,
                                 nir_intrinsic_load_vertex_id);
   nir_ssa_dest_init(&vertex_id->instr, &vertex_id->dest, 1, 32, "vertexid");
   nir_builder_instr_insert(b, &vertex_id->instr);


   /* vertex 0: -1.0, -1.0
    * vertex 1: -1.0,  1.0
    * vertex 2:  1.0, -1.0
    * vertex 3:  1.0,  1.0
    *
    * so:
    *
    * channel 0 is vertex_id < 2 ? -1.0 :  1.0
    * channel 1 is vertex id & 1 ?  1.0 : -1.0
    */

   nir_ssa_def *one = nir_imm_int(b, 1);
   nir_ssa_def *c0cmp = nir_ilt(b, &vertex_id->dest.ssa, nir_imm_int(b, 2));
   nir_ssa_def *c1cmp = nir_ieq(b, nir_iand(b, &vertex_id->dest.ssa, one), one);

   nir_ssa_def *comp[4];
   comp[0] = nir_bcsel(b, c0cmp,
                       nir_imm_float(b, -1.0f),
                       nir_imm_float(b, 1.0f));

   comp[1] = nir_bcsel(b, c1cmp,
                       nir_imm_float(b, 1.0f),
                       nir_imm_float(b, -1.0f));
   comp[2] = nir_imm_float(b, 0.0f);
   comp[3] = nir_imm_float(b, 1.0f);
   return nir_vec(b, comp, 4);
}

static nir_shader *
get_color_clear_rect_vs()
{
   nir_builder b;
   const nir_shader_compiler_options *options = v3dv_pipeline_get_nir_options();
   nir_builder_init_simple_shader(&b, NULL, MESA_SHADER_VERTEX, options);
   b.shader->info.name = ralloc_strdup(b.shader, "meta clear vs");

   const struct glsl_type *vec4 = glsl_vec4_type();
   nir_variable *vs_out_pos =
      nir_variable_create(b.shader, nir_var_shader_out, vec4, "gl_Position");
   vs_out_pos->data.location = VARYING_SLOT_POS;

   nir_ssa_def *pos = gen_rect_vertices(&b);
   nir_store_var(&b, vs_out_pos, pos, 0xf);

   return b.shader;
}

static nir_shader *
get_color_clear_rect_fs(struct v3dv_render_pass *pass, uint32_t rt_idx)
{
   nir_builder b;
   const nir_shader_compiler_options *options = v3dv_pipeline_get_nir_options();
   nir_builder_init_simple_shader(&b, NULL, MESA_SHADER_FRAGMENT, options);
   b.shader->info.name = ralloc_strdup(b.shader, "meta clear fs");

   /* Since our implementation can only clear one RT at a time we know there
    * is a single subpass with a single attachment.
    */
   assert(pass->attachment_count == 1);
   enum pipe_format pformat =
      vk_format_to_pipe_format(pass->attachments[0].desc.format);
   const struct glsl_type *fs_out_type =
      util_format_is_float(pformat) ? glsl_vec4_type() : glsl_uvec4_type();

   nir_variable *fs_out_color =
      nir_variable_create(b.shader, nir_var_shader_out, fs_out_type, "out_color");
   fs_out_color->data.location = FRAG_RESULT_DATA0 + rt_idx;

   nir_intrinsic_instr *color_load =
      nir_intrinsic_instr_create(b.shader, nir_intrinsic_load_push_constant);
   nir_intrinsic_set_base(color_load, 0);
   nir_intrinsic_set_range(color_load, 16);
   color_load->src[0] = nir_src_for_ssa(nir_imm_int(&b, 0));
   color_load->num_components = 4;
   nir_ssa_dest_init(&color_load->instr, &color_load->dest, 4, 32, "clear color");
   nir_builder_instr_insert(&b, &color_load->instr);

   nir_store_var(&b, fs_out_color, &color_load->dest.ssa, 0xf);

   return b.shader;
}

               uint32_t attachment_count,
               const VkClearAttachment *attachments,
               uint32_t base_layer,
               uint32_t layer_count)
{
   struct v3dv_job *job = cmd_buffer->state.job;
   assert(job);

   /* Save a copy of the current subpass tiling spec, since we are about to
    * split the job for the clear and we will need to then resume it with the
    * same specs.
    */
   struct v3dv_frame_tiling subpass_tiling;
   memcpy(&subpass_tiling, &job->frame_tiling, sizeof(subpass_tiling));

   job = v3dv_cmd_buffer_start_job(cmd_buffer, cmd_buffer->state.subpass_idx);

   /* vkCmdClearAttachments runs inside a render pass */
   job->is_subpass_continue = true;

   emit_tlb_clear_job(cmd_buffer,
                      attachment_count,
                      attachments,
                      base_layer, layer_count);

   /* Since vkCmdClearAttachments executes inside a render pass command, this
    * will emit the binner FLUSH packet. Notice that this won't emit the
    * subpass RCL for this job though because it will see that the job has
    * recorded its own RCL.
    */
   v3dv_cmd_buffer_finish_job(cmd_buffer);

   /* Make sure we have an active job to continue the render pass recording
    * after the clear.
    */
   job = v3dv_cmd_buffer_start_job(cmd_buffer, cmd_buffer->state.subpass_idx);

   v3dv_job_start_frame(job,
                        subpass_tiling.width,
                        subpass_tiling.height,
                        subpass_tiling.layers,
                        subpass_tiling.render_target_count,
                        subpass_tiling.internal_bpp);

   job->is_subpass_continue = true;
}

static bool
is_subrect(const VkRect2D *r0, const VkRect2D *r1)
{
   return r0->offset.x <= r1->offset.x &&
          r0->offset.y <= r1->offset.y &&
          r0->offset.x + r0->extent.width >= r1->offset.x + r1->extent.width &&
          r0->offset.y + r0->extent.height >= r1->offset.y + r1->extent.height;
}

static bool
can_use_tlb_clear(struct v3dv_cmd_buffer *cmd_buffer,
                  uint32_t rect_count,
                  const VkClearRect* rects)
{
   const struct v3dv_framebuffer *framebuffer = cmd_buffer->state.framebuffer;

   const VkRect2D *render_area = &cmd_buffer->state.render_area;

   /* Check if we are clearing a single region covering the entire framebuffer
    * and that we are not constrained by the current render area.
    */
   const VkRect2D fb_rect = {
      {0, 0},
      { framebuffer->width, framebuffer->height}
   };

   bool ok =
      rect_count == 1 &&
      is_subrect(&rects[0].rect, &fb_rect) &&
      is_subrect(render_area, &fb_rect);

   if (!ok)
      return false;

   /* If we have enabled scissors, make sure they don't reduce the clear area.
    * For simplicity, we only check the case for a single scissor.
    */
   const struct v3dv_scissor_state *scissor_state =
      &cmd_buffer->state.dynamic.scissor;

   if (scissor_state->count == 0)
      return true;

   if (scissor_state->count == 1)
      return is_subrect(&scissor_state->scissors[0], &fb_rect);

   return false;
}

void
v3dv_CmdClearAttachments(VkCommandBuffer commandBuffer,
                         uint32_t attachmentCount,
                         const VkClearAttachment *pAttachments,
                         uint32_t rectCount,
                         const VkClearRect *pRects)
{
   V3DV_FROM_HANDLE(v3dv_cmd_buffer, cmd_buffer, commandBuffer);

   /* We can only clear attachments in the current subpass */
   assert(attachmentCount <= 5); /* 4 color + D/S */

   /* Check if we can use the fast path via the TLB */
   if (can_use_tlb_clear(cmd_buffer, rectCount, pRects)) {
      emit_tlb_clear(cmd_buffer, attachmentCount, pAttachments,
                     pRects[0].baseArrayLayer, pRects[0].layerCount);
      return;
   }

   /* Otherwise, fall back to drawing rects with the clear value */
   const struct v3dv_subpass *subpass =
      &cmd_buffer->state.pass->subpasses[cmd_buffer->state.subpass_idx];

   for (uint32_t i = 0; i < attachmentCount; i++) {
      uint32_t attachment_idx = VK_ATTACHMENT_UNUSED;
      int32_t rt_idx = -1;

      if (pAttachments[i].aspectMask & VK_IMAGE_ASPECT_COLOR_BIT) {
         rt_idx = pAttachments[i].colorAttachment;
         attachment_idx = subpass->color_attachments[rt_idx].attachment;
      } else if (pAttachments[i].aspectMask & (VK_IMAGE_ASPECT_DEPTH_BIT |
                                               VK_IMAGE_ASPECT_STENCIL_BIT)) {
         attachment_idx = subpass->ds_attachment.attachment;
      }

      if (attachment_idx == VK_ATTACHMENT_UNUSED)
         continue;

      if (rt_idx != -1) {
         for (uint32_t j = 0; j < rectCount; j++) {
            emit_color_clear_rect(cmd_buffer,
                                  rt_idx,
                                  pAttachments[i].clearValue.color,
                                  &pRects[j]);
         }
      } else {
         for (uint32_t j = 0; j < rectCount; j++) {
            emit_ds_clear_rect(cmd_buffer,
                               pAttachments[i].clearValue.depthStencil,
                               &pRects[j]);
         }
      }
   }
}
